Output 5b8870353c6326b131a5810b575751fd297a4970a8b495ddaf6fad0ee3a20665:3

value
110086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44402f4c0cd3cdefb1acd361329a34bc9b29d206 OP_EQUAL
address
37utmDtr93VWqiaheZFDkSgVdQYJqdm4Hr
transaction
5b8870353c6326b131a5810b575751fd297a4970a8b495ddaf6fad0ee3a20665
confirmations
40574
spent
true